Just gotta say that these aren’t all the same park. There ARE photos from Six Flags New Orleans, but at least some of...
saitamarama liked this Except only one of these photos is from New Orleans, the rest are from Japan, Ohio, Denmark, Ukraine, Kansas, and and...
mittensfelicityromney liked this